summary of some things that i have learned so far:
-act on your faith; use the gift of faith that God
has given to you to share with others the good news.
-Jesus loves us more than we can imagine; before our
creation, He knew that He would die on the cross for us.
-suffering; it is inevitable, but should we curse God?
no, it is the opposite- we should praise God, because
in that suffering, we are being transformed and are
given a better understanding of what Christ has suffered.
-loving your neighbors is not mere acts of kindness, but
rather it is sharing Jesus with them, so that they can
also have the salvation that we have in Christ alone.
-God does not discriminate against anyone; in fact, He
calls out to even those considered to be the worst sinners.
-repentance is not simply sadness, but it is godly sorrow,
meaning that those who repent will turn away from sin.
